‘Part of a nice evening’ BY TOM MUNDS TMUNDS@COLORADOCOMMUNITYMEDIA.COM
The attire varied from shorts and sweatshirts to formal dresses and suits as about 100 young men and women attended the annual after-prom event at Englewood High School. Araya Miller attended her first prom and her first after prom. “This is part of a nice evening,” she said. “The prom was fun because I got to dance a lot and I love to dance. This after prom is fun too. The food was good and there is a lot to do. All this makes it worth staying up all night.” Kelly Prien headed the group of volunteers
that organized and put on after prom. Prien said the decorations at the entrance were donated and they were awesome with a theme about water, the beach and characters like “Father Neptune.” There was free food, games and activities. Students were given raffle tickets to fill out and there was an array of items that were given away during the night. Prien said she and the other parents at the event felt after prom went well. “There were quite a few kids who joined us,” she said. “I was there and from watching them and from the comments from the kids, it seemed like everyone had a good time.”
